Advancements in research and technology are accelerating drug development like never before. Artificial intelligence, data analytics, and advanced laboratory techniques are helping scientists identify effective treatments faster and with greater accuracy. These innovations reduce development time while maintaining strict safety and quality standards, ensuring patients receive reliable and effective medicines when they need them most.

Biotechnology and personalized medicine are also reshaping patient care. Treatments are increasingly designed to target specific diseases at the molecular level, offering better results with fewer side effects. Personalized therapies allow doctors to choose medicines based on a patient’s genetic makeup, leading to improved recovery rates and better quality of life. For patients facing chronic or life-threatening conditions, these breakthroughs bring renewed hope and confidence in modern healthcare.
